In a continuation of Live Design's "When the Lights Went Out" series, freelance sound engineer and one of Live Design's 30 Under 30 in 2018, Brandon Blackwell discusses how he is coping with COVID-19 closings throughout the live events industry. Since graduating Full Sail University with a B.A. in Show Production and Touring, Blackwell has toured the world with Pharrell, Ne-Yo, Tori Kelly, Puff Daddy, A$AP Rocky, Usher, and more. These past few months, he has engaged in new hobbies, from day trading stocks to streaming video games on Twitch, to foster income.
